Gas Turbine Filter Manufacturers Ensuring Efficiency and Performance
In the realm of industrial power generation and aviation, gas turbines serve as pivotal components, driving efficiency and performance in energy production and aircraft propulsion. However, the operation of gas turbines is not without challenges; one of the most critical issues is the management of air quality entering the turbine. This is where gas turbine filter manufacturers play a vital role. These manufacturers are dedicated to producing high-quality filtration systems that protect gas turbines from harmful contaminants while enhancing their overall operational efficiency.
Gas turbines operate by drawing in large volumes of air, which is then compressed and mixed with fuel to generate power. The introduction of particulates, dust, and other impurities can lead to significant operational issues, including compressor fouling, blade erosion, and reduced efficiency. Therefore, implementing effective air filtration is essential in ensuring the longevity and reliability of these turbines. Gas turbine filter manufacturers develop specialized filters designed to capture a wide range of contaminants, thereby safeguarding the turbines from damage and extending their service life.
The design and technology of gas turbine filters have evolved significantly over the years. Modern filters utilize advanced materials and designs to improve filtration efficiency while minimizing airflow resistance. Manufacturers focus on a variety of filter types, such as synthetic mesh filters, high-temperature filters, and pleated media filters, each tailored to meet different operational requirements. Synthetic filters, for example, offer enhanced durability and efficiency in extreme environments, making them ideal for use in power plants and aerospace applications.
